I spent five weeks or so in (but mostly around) there many moons ago and saw nothing. Your best bet would likely be some trekking peaks in the Langtang or near (i.e., before entering) the Annapurna Sanctuary. People have climbed some ice routes in winter, but you'd have to fly into to someplace like Namche Bazaar, etc.

I'd see if you could check some message boards in Kathmandu for more info. There's got to be a place in Thamel with some information. You could also try bugging Elizabeth Hawley. She's debriefed every expedition that come through since the 60's I believe.
